Karaniwang pagkakamali:
Learners sometimes confuse 'allow' with 'let'. 'Allow' is slightly more formal and often needs an object before the action, e.g., 'allow someone to do something'.

Karaniwang pagkakamali:
Learners may confuse this meaning with giving permission; here, it is about possibility, not authority.

Karaniwang pagkakamali:
Learners may confuse this with giving permission; here it means making a plan with extra resources or time.

Karaniwang pagkakamali:
'Allow that' is formal and rare in speech; learners may overuse it instead of 'admit' or 'agree'.
